- 博客(24)
- 资源 (2)
- 问答 (1)
- 收藏
- 关注
原创 js面试之事件循环机制
scriptsetTimeout/setIntervalrenderingsetImmediate……promise.then/catch…process.nextTick……先执行同步任务同步任务执行完成之后执行异步任务异步任务包括宏任务和微任务将宏任务添加到宏任务队列将微任务添加到对应的微任务队列先执行一个宏任务,宏任务执行完成之后产看是否有可执行的微任务,如果有则执行,没有则进行下一个宏任务例运行结果:pro1end!!!pro2then1then2before t
2023-06-28 14:22:20
222
原创 进制转换之栈
算法如下:第一步:将num取余base的值入栈第二步,将num的值变成num/base的整数部分第三步:重复第一步和第二步,直到num=0第四步:将栈内元素逐个出栈,用一个空字符串将其加起来,由于栈的特点是后进先出(LIFO),所以这时我们就得到了转换后的数值(如果想拿到数值,可以通过(parseInt(converted))来获得这个方法只能用来转换base在2-9的情况
2023-03-03 18:25:07
248
原创 js数组的复制
这种通过"="进行数组赋值的方法其实为浅复制将原来数组的地址赋值给新数组,这样新旧数组指向的是同一个地址,当某一个发生改变时,这两个数组都会改变。
2023-03-03 12:05:17
232
原创 python☞列表复制
Python列表用等号赋值并不是将列表完整的赋值给另一个列表,而是通过引用另一个列表的地址。但是还有几种方法也可以指向不同的内存地址空间
2022-10-03 17:45:55
239
原创 isinstance()函数Python
Python 中的isinstance()函数,isinstance()是Python中的一个内建函数。是用来判断一个对象的变量类型。
2022-10-01 14:07:46
644
原创 eclipse小应用程序||eclipse切换低版本JDK实现JavaAPPlet
applet在JDK 9中就已经弃用了,我也没想到学校课程中会用到这个(由于我的懒惰,不想重新下载一个低版本的JDK,所以在这个上面耗费了好长时间最终采用了我一开始就想到的办法)一个eclipse中应用多个jdk
2022-09-13 23:08:59
1447
4
原创 配置JDK环境
有很多人都遇到了Could not find folder ‘tools’ inside SDK ‘…’,这是因为没有配置环境变量。
2022-08-30 08:11:15
598
原创 JS中的this指向
因为将obj对象中的detial函数赋给了CC,此时的this指针已经和obj对象没有关系了,于是绑定的是默认的window.name,所以最后的结果是Jerry。此时通过obj2调用了obj1.foo()函数,但是我们要注意,this指的是最近一次调用它的对象,所以这时仍然是obj1对象。如果将obj改为了foo,那么函数中的obj也需要改为foo,这样子就很是麻烦。此时调用foo函数的是obj.foo()函数,因此最终会绑定到obj这个对象上。在它的调用位置中,是通过某个对象发起的函数调用。...
2022-07-25 19:43:11
120
原创 单片机原理及应用第四版林立课后选择题
(1) 单片机又称为单片微计算机,最初的英文缩写是______。 A.MCP B.CPU C.DPJ D.SCM(2) Intel公司的MCS-51系列单片机是______的单片机。 A.1位 B.4位 C.8位 D.16位(3) 单片机的特点里没有包括在内的是______。 A.集成度高 B.功耗低 C.密封性强 D.性价比高(4) 单片机的发展趋势中没有包括的是______。 A.高性能 B.高价格 C.低功耗 D.高性价比
2022-06-15 19:55:32
13931
8
原创 Linux操作系统期末考试试题及答案-选择题
1、以长格式列目录时,若文件test的权限描述为:drwxrw-r–,则文件test的类型及文件主的权限是__A____。A.目录文件、读写执行 B.目录文件、读写 C.普通文件、读写 D.普通文件、读2、当字符串用单引号(’’)括起来时,SHELL将__C____。A.解释引号内的特殊字符 B.执行引号中的命令 C.不解释引号内的特殊字符 D.结束进程3、/etc/shadow文件中存放_B_____。A.用户账号基本信息 B.用户口令的加密信息 C.用户组信息 D.文件系统信息4、Linux系统中,用户
2022-06-15 19:18:58
27759
1
原创 Linux第六章课后题6-4
已知有两个文本文件f1和f2,把f1文件中的第5~9行剪切并插入粘贴到f2文件的第3行后,再把f2文件中的所有read字符串全部改写成reading,最后在f1文件后附加上当前时间。利用vi编辑器写出以上操作步骤及其相关命令。......
2022-06-15 19:06:41
1397
原创 Linux第六章课后题
(1) 插入2019年日历,并把该文件命名为2019.txt。(2) 把4、5、6月的日历整体向右移动一个制表位。(3) 把该日历的标题“2019”改为“2019年全年日历”。(4) 删除1、2、3月的日历,然后予以恢复。(5) 把7、8、9月的日历整体移到日历的最后面。(6) 依次检索字符串“30”,如果每个月的最后一天为“30”,则删除该字符串“30”。(7) 显示行号。(8) 在该vi编辑器中统计该文件的大小。...
2022-06-15 19:05:05
3723
原创 Linux操作系统-shell程序设计最全版本(含运行截图)
Shell程序设计(一)Shell简介主要功能:命令解释程序/作为一种高级程序实际语言。(1)查看当前系统支持的Shell主文件夹——其他位置——计算机——etc——passwdcat /etc/shellshead /etc/shellsmore /etc/shells例如tcsh --version查看显示的Shell版本(2)Shell脚本的建立与执行脚本的建立vi编辑器或cat利用vi编辑器进行录入vi 脚本名录入ls -lc.
2022-05-03 17:09:36
3730
程序设计基础-学生信息管理系统(添加、修改、删除、查找)-C++版本源程序文件
2022-05-03
Linux操作系统-shell命令
2022-04-29
Java Applet还有学习的必要吗
2022-09-08
首次接触Python的软件推荐
2022-06-25
TA创建的收藏夹 TA关注的收藏夹
TA关注的人